BAKERSFIELD, Calif. (KGET) -- Bakersfield Police Chief Greg Terry said the death of 8-year-old Genesis Mata is one of the most horrific cases the department has ever seen.

Terry joined 17 News at Sunrise to talk about recent tragedies, including Genesis' death and the fatal shooting on Rhone Drive.

"This is one of the most horrific cases our investigators have ever had to deal with," Terry said about Genesis. "But the job of the police officer is exposure to trauma in a variety of different ways, every single day."
